はてなブックマークアプリ

サクサク読めて、
アプリ限定の機能も多数!

アプリで開く

はてなブックマーク

  • はてなブックマークって?
  • アプリ・拡張の紹介
  • ユーザー登録
  • ログイン
  • Hatena

はてなブックマーク

トップへ戻る

  • 総合
    • 人気
    • 新着
    • IT
    • 最新ガジェット
    • 自然科学
    • 経済・金融
    • おもしろ
    • マンガ
    • ゲーム
    • はてなブログ(総合)
  • 一般
    • 人気
    • 新着
    • 社会ニュース
    • 地域
    • 国際
    • 天気
    • グルメ
    • 映画・音楽
    • スポーツ
    • はてな匿名ダイアリー
    • はてなブログ(一般)
  • 世の中
    • 人気
    • 新着
    • 新型コロナウイルス
    • 働き方
    • 生き方
    • 地域
    • 医療・ヘルス
    • 教育
    • はてな匿名ダイアリー
    • はてなブログ(世の中)
  • 政治と経済
    • 人気
    • 新着
    • 政治
    • 経済・金融
    • 企業
    • 仕事・就職
    • マーケット
    • 国際
    • はてなブログ(政治と経済)
  • 暮らし
    • 人気
    • 新着
    • カルチャー・ライフスタイル
    • ファッション
    • 運動・エクササイズ
    • 結婚・子育て
    • 住まい
    • グルメ
    • 相続
    • はてなブログ(暮らし)
    • 掃除・整理整頓
    • 雑貨
    • 買ってよかったもの
    • 旅行
    • アウトドア
    • 趣味
  • 学び
    • 人気
    • 新着
    • 人文科学
    • 社会科学
    • 自然科学
    • 語学
    • ビジネス・経営学
    • デザイン
    • 法律
    • 本・書評
    • 将棋・囲碁
    • はてなブログ(学び)
  • テクノロジー
    • 人気
    • 新着
    • IT
    • セキュリティ技術
    • はてなブログ(テクノロジー)
    • AI・機械学習
    • プログラミング
    • エンジニア
  • おもしろ
    • 人気
    • 新着
    • まとめ
    • ネタ
    • おもしろ
    • これはすごい
    • かわいい
    • 雑学
    • 癒やし
    • はてなブログ(おもしろ)
  • エンタメ
    • 人気
    • 新着
    • スポーツ
    • 映画
    • 音楽
    • アイドル
    • 芸能
    • お笑い
    • サッカー
    • 話題の動画
    • はてなブログ(エンタメ)
  • アニメとゲーム
    • 人気
    • 新着
    • マンガ
    • Webマンガ
    • ゲーム
    • 任天堂
    • PlayStation
    • アニメ
    • バーチャルYouTuber
    • オタクカルチャー
    • はてなブログ(アニメとゲーム)
    • はてなブログ(ゲーム)
  • おすすめ

    新内閣発足

『GeeksforGeeks』

  • 人気
  • 新着
  • すべて
  • DSA Tutorial - GeeksforGeeks

    4 users

    www.geeksforgeeks.org

    Data structures manage how data is stored and accessed, while Algorithms focus on processing this data. Examples of data structures are Array, Linked List, Tree and Heap, and examples of algorithms are Binary Search, Quick Sort and Merge Sort. Why to Learn DSA?Foundation for almost every software like GPS, Search Engines, AI ChatBots, Gaming Apps, Databases, Web Applications, etcTop Companies like

    • テクノロジー
    • 2023/07/24 23:12
    • algorithm
    • Binary Search - GeeksforGeeks

      3 users

      www.geeksforgeeks.org

      Binary Search is a searching algorithm that operates on a sorted or monotonic search space, repeatedly dividing it into halves to find a target value or optimal answer in logarithmic time O(log N). Binary Search AlgorithmConditions to apply Binary Search Algorithm in a Data StructureTo apply Binary Search algorithm: The data structure must be sorted.Access to any element of the data structure shou

      • テクノロジー
      • 2019/01/23 16:37
      • algorithm
      • Leaky bucket algorithm - GeeksforGeeks

        4 users

        www.geeksforgeeks.org

        In computer networks, congestion occurs when data traffic exceeds the available bandwidth and leads to packet loss, delays, and reduced performance. Traffic shaping can prevent and reduce congestion in a network. It is a technique used to regulate data flow by controlling the rate at which packets are sent into the network. There are 2 types of traffic shaping algorithms: Leaky Bucket Token Bucket

        • テクノロジー
        • 2018/02/21 11:38
        • Longest Common Subsequence (LCS) - GeeksforGeeks

          3 users

          www.geeksforgeeks.org

          Given two strings, s1 and s2, the task is to find the length of the Longest Common Subsequence. If there is no common subsequence, return 0. A subsequence is a string generated from the original string by deleting 0 or more characters, without changing the relative order of the remaining characters. For example, subsequences of "ABC" are "", "A", "B", "C", "AB", "AC", "BC" and "ABC". In general, a

          • 世の中
          • 2017/08/23 14:17
          • Top 10 Algorithms in Interview Questions - GeeksforGeeks

            8 users

            www.geeksforgeeks.org

            Getting ready for a tech job interview? Algorithms are really important! Companies often ask questions that require problem-solving skills. In this article, we'll look at the top 10 algorithms commonly used in interviews. Each algorithm is like a powerful tool in your problem-solving toolbox. Knowing them well can really help you handle different technical challenges during interviews. Let's break

            • テクノロジー
            • 2016/07/06 22:53
            • algorithm
            • programming
            • あとで読む
            • Algorithms Tutorial - GeeksforGeeks

              5 users

              www.geeksforgeeks.org

              Algorithm is a step-by-step procedure for solving a problem or accomplishing a task. In the context of data structures and algorithms, it is a set of well-defined instructions for performing a specific computational task. Algorithms are fundamental to computer science and play a very important role in designing efficient solutions for various problems. Understanding algorithms is essential for any

              • テクノロジー
              • 2016/07/02 15:03
              • algorithm
              • Top 10 Algorithms and Data Structures for Competitive Programming - GeeksforGeeks

                7 users

                www.geeksforgeeks.org

                In this post, we will discuss Important top 10 algorithms and data structures for competitive coding. Topics : Graph algorithmsDynamic programmingSearching and Sorting:Number theory and Other MathematicalGeometrical and Network Flow AlgorithmsData StructuresThe links below cover most important algorithms and data structure topics: Best Algorithms and Data Structures for Competitive ProgrammingGrap

                • テクノロジー
                • 2016/05/15 23:44
                • データ構造
                • 競技プログラミング
                • アルゴリズム
                • プログラミング
                • Longest Increasing Subsequence Size (N log N) - GeeksforGeeks

                  3 users

                  www.geeksforgeeks.org

                  Given an array arr[] of size N, the task is to find the length of the Longest Increasing Subsequence (LIS) i.e., the longest possible subsequence in which the elements of the subsequence are sorted in increasing order, in O(N log N). Examples: Input: arr[] = {3, 10, 2, 1, 20} Output: 3 Explanation: The longest increasing subsequence is 3, 10, 20 Input: arr[] = {3, 2} Output:1 Explanation: The long

                  • テクノロジー
                  • 2015/10/04 13:13
                  • Algorithm
                  • GeeksforGeeks

                    3 users

                    www.geeksforgeeks.org

                    A-143, 7th Floor, Sovereign Corporate Tower, Sector- 136, Noida, Uttar Pradesh (201305)

                    • テクノロジー
                    • 2015/10/02 11:33
                    • algorithm
                    • Articulation Points (or Cut Vertices) in a Graph - GeeksforGeeks

                      3 users

                      www.geeksforgeeks.org

                      Given an undirected graph with V vertices and E edges (edges[][]), Your task is to return all the articulation points in the graph. If no such point exists, return {-1}. Note: An articulation point is a vertex whose removal, along with all its connected edges, increases the number of connected components in the graph. The graph may contain more than one connected component.Examples: Input: V = 5,

                      • テクノロジー
                      • 2014/01/26 16:43
                      • 数学
                      • extern Keyword in C - GeeksforGeeks

                        3 users

                        www.geeksforgeeks.org

                        In C, the extern keyword is used to declare a variable or a function whose definition is present in some other file. Basically, it extends the visibility of the variables and functions in C to multiple source files. Before going deeper into the topic, we need to know about a few terms: Declaration: A declaration only tells the compiler about the existence of an identifier and its type.Definition:

                        • テクノロジー
                        • 2013/04/02 10:03
                        • C
                        • c++
                        • programming
                        • GeeksforGeeks

                          57 users

                          www.geeksforgeeks.org

                          Tech Interview 101 - From DSA to System Design for Working Professionals

                          • テクノロジー
                          • 2011/08/09 05:16
                          • algorithm
                          • プログラミング
                          • アルゴリズム
                          • 学習

                          このページはまだ
                          ブックマークされていません

                          このページを最初にブックマークしてみませんか?

                          『GeeksforGeeks』の新着エントリーを見る

                          キーボードショートカット一覧

                          j次のブックマーク

                          k前のブックマーク

                          lあとで読む

                          eコメント一覧を開く

                          oページを開く

                          はてなブックマーク

                          • 総合
                          • 一般
                          • 世の中
                          • 政治と経済
                          • 暮らし
                          • 学び
                          • テクノロジー
                          • エンタメ
                          • アニメとゲーム
                          • おもしろ
                          • アプリ・拡張機能
                          • 開発ブログ
                          • ヘルプ
                          • お問い合わせ
                          • ガイドライン
                          • 利用規約
                          • プライバシーポリシー
                          • 利用者情報の外部送信について
                          • ガイドライン
                          • 利用規約
                          • プライバシーポリシー
                          • 利用者情報の外部送信について

                          公式Twitter

                          • 公式アカウント
                          • ホットエントリー

                          はてなのサービス

                          • はてなブログ
                          • はてなブログPro
                          • 人力検索はてな
                          • はてなブログ タグ
                          • はてなニュース
                          • ソレドコ
                          • App Storeからダウンロード
                          • Google Playで手に入れよう
                          Copyright © 2005-2025 Hatena. All Rights Reserved.
                          設定を変更しましたx